Hello, I am writing a research paper which I intend to submit to major magazines for publication. The paper concerns the death penalty as it pertains to the psychology of belief, arguing the death penalty is irrational and explores why good people can be lead to do bad things.

Just to cover all my bases, I am interested in hearing PRO-death penalty arguments, because it seems to me the only principle argument advocates argue is revenge / retribution. What other fundamental arguments, in principle, are there? Thanks much!
I do not want to get into a personal discussion of my own feelings about the death penalty. But another argument for it is the idea of being done with a person who is a danger to society. There is the finality of never having to face the same person committing the same crimes again.
